One arrested or violating Monicon order

Home Minister has ordered the arrest of an individual, currently on the monicon system, for violating the terms of the system. Under the powers granted to Home Minister, Mohamed Mafaaz Hussain Saleem (18) of G. Shaaraaz was arrested.

A total of 14 had been tagged under the monicon system. Mafaaz is the first individual to have violated the terms and placed under arrest among the 14.

Home Minister had previously stated that those under monicon system was abiding by their terms.

While Mafaaz had been placed under arrest, separate instances of gang violence had taken place in Male' last night and the night before.

Those individuals tagged under the monicon system, are required to be at home between 8 pm and 6 am and have to provide information on who are and will be living with the individual under monitoring. Additionally, the individuals will not be allowed to leave the country before permission from the Ministry and their movements will be restricted from the areas specified in the order. The individual's finances and communications will be under surveillance, they will have to regularly report to the Police. They will be will outfitted with the tag and their movements will be tracked round the clock. In addition, photos of the individuals and their homes will be taken for documentation.
